Position Summary:
Responsible for conducting a thorough review of the department Operating Room (OR) scheduling related processes and resources to maximize the utilization of the department’s block of time. Manages the department OR schedule to fill any gaps within the department allocation of the block of time. Serves as a resource for department, faculty and staff.
Functions as a liaison with other UMass Memorial Health Care (UMMHC) departments including Operating Room, Central Scheduling, Information Systems and ambulatory clinics to ensure integration with institutional and department goals and objectives. Sites may include practices on the University, Memorial, Hahnemann and Marlboro campuses as well as community based private and Group physician practices. Participates in focus groups and/or committees as representative of the department, as assigned.
